Output 15bbcf60d0189bfff040298a4e439f13dc9c80f7ccb7de799e42e7500f129b0a:0

value
67839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5485ee187f7f715403cf4d3b6ac185fda1f24dd OP_EQUAL
address
3JDYvfVeWe6Ahgv9ihEVyqyY1fi7C7PXPh
transaction
15bbcf60d0189bfff040298a4e439f13dc9c80f7ccb7de799e42e7500f129b0a
spent
true